Lithography replicates patterns (positive and negative masks) into underlying substrates (Fig. 3.8).Lithography is further subdivided into photolithography, electron beam lithography, X-ray and extreme … WebPhotomasks used for optical lithography contain the pattern of the integrated circuits. The basis is a so called blank: a glass substrate which is coated with a chrome and a resist layer. The resist is sensitive to electron beams and can be transferred into the chrome layer via etch processes.

Extreme ultraviolet lithography (also known as EUV or EUVL) is an optical lithography technology used in semiconductor device fabrication to make integrated circuits (ICs). It uses extreme ultraviolet (EUV) wavelengths near 13.5 nm, using a laser-pulsed tin (Sn) droplet plasma, to produce a pattern by using a reflective photomask ... flip flops in a lawn chairWebLithography is important not only because it is needed for all masking levels.
